Deputa is a village located in Bhalukpong Taluka of West Kameng district in Arunachal Pradesh. Around 5 families reside in Deputa village. Deputa village is administered by Sarpanch(Head of village) who is elected every five years.
As per the Census India 2011, Deputa village has population of 7 of which 5 are males and 2 are females. The population of children between age 0-6 is 0 which is 0 of total population.
The sex-ratio of Deputa village is around
400 compared to
938 which is average of Arunachal Pradesh state. The literacy rate of Deputa village is 100% out of which 100% males are literate and 100% females are literate. There are 0 Scheduled Caste (SC) and 100% Scheduled Tribe (ST) of total population in Deputa village.
